Affordable housing has been a decades-long struggle in Boston, and the 2020 Greater Boston Housing Report Card says the coronavirus pandemic only made it worse.

Experts believe inclusionary development policies, such as mandating low-cost housing units, may be crucial in making housing more accessible to low and moderate-income Bostonians while increasing the accessibility of health-beneficial resources to those populations.
